Could be that the spawning Chub in the pond were caught from the river, then Introduced & therefore not stock fish thus still have the urge to breed??

 

I think most populations of stillwater chub got there either by accident or by theft - the club waters I used to fish which contained them were populated with fish nicked from rivers during club matches. I remember seeing some dead barbel in the margins after one such match...

 

Another water had some very shifty looking committee members after an environment agency survey found chub in the pond.
